May Days on the First Broad River Paddle Trail, Zion to Shelby, NC 5/24
Making our way out of the Foothills countryside and into the city. The put in spot is privately owned by the Pentecostal Church. They have been very generous in allowing access for Broad Riverkeeper special outings and events, including 9 years of the annual Sarah Sweep! Shelby folks who see this river from a boat often comment that they had no idea of the river’s beauty here, a real wilderness just outside the city.
Meet in the Church’s lower parking lot at 10:00 am sharp! We will unload boats and gear, then take all the vehicles to the take-out spot and shuttle back to begin paddling. This section is approximately 6.5 miles and includes a difficult portage around Shelby’s water intake dam. We will be on the water for about 5 hours, including a stop for lunch.
